In Tom Cruise's latest movie, the action star finds himself in a futuristic sci-fi war complete with a robotic battle suit. Edge of Tomorrow (originally called and based on the comic series All You Need is Kill) is a new story involving aliens, time loops, and death. This new movie also stars Emily Blunt and Bill Paxton.

Here is the official synopsis for Edge of Tomorrow:

Lt. Col. Bill Cage (Tom Cruise) is an officer who has never seen a day of combat when he is unceremoniously dropped into what amounts to little more than a suicide mission. Killed within minutes, Cage now finds himself inexplicably thrown into a time loop-forcing him to live out the same brutal combat over and over, fighting and dying again...and again. But with each battle, Cage becomes able to engage the adversaries with increasing skill, alongside Special Forces warrior Rita Vrataski (Emily Blunt). And, as Cage and Rita take the fight to the aliens, each repeated encounter gets them one step closer to defeating the enemy.

Clearly this is an interesting concept, but will this movie become boring or even excessively violent as it progresses? Other movies of this nature come to mind including Groundhog Day and Source Code, but this film's subject matter (a war with aliens) will definitely separate it from the others.
